I am trying to use the USB Imaging on a Wyse V90LE. I have tried 3 USB drives with the following results.
Lexar JumpDrive 512MB – I was able to set this up. It boots and loads the software. Unfortunately the drive is too small for the image.
SanDisk 4GB – Yes, I did remove the U3 stuff. I reformatted the drive and loaded the DOS files. I have been unable to get this drive to boot. On boot up the cursor is in the upper left hand corner of the screen.
Lexar JumpDrive FireFly 4 GB – I reformatted the drive and loaded the DOS files. I have been unable to get this drive to boot. On boot up the cursor is in the upper left hand corner of the screen.
I have reread the documentation that came with the USB Imaging software and done some research in the forums without success. Normally I would think I am doing something wrong but I was able to get the 512MB unit working fairly quickly.
In the notes that came with the Imaging software it is documented as being tested with a Lexar JumpDrive FireFly 2GB which is going to be my next purchase if I can’t come up with anything better.
Is there something I am doing wrong? Is it something about 4GB versions that don’t work? Why are some USB drives bootable and others aren’t?

June 29, 2009 at 11:14 am #16187I have successfully used
1. SanDisk Cruzer micro 1 GB
2. SanDisk Cruzer micro 2 GB
3. Kingston DataTraveler 4 GB
4. SanDisk Cruzer micro 4 GB
5. Kingston DataTraveler 8 GB
6. SanDisk Cruzer Titanium 2 GB
7. SanDisk Cruzer Titanium 16GBAll are working perfectly with the Wyse USB imaging solution.
